We are recruiting for a Procurement / Purchasing Manager to lead purchasing activities across a well-established automotive manufacturing business in Coventry.

This is a key role, working closely with Supply Chain, Operations, Engineering and Quality, with responsibility for supplier performance, cost reduction, material availability and supporting the overall competitiveness and profitability of the business.

The Role

  • Leading and managing the Purchasing team and wider purchasing activities
  • Developing and implementing purchasing strategies aligned with business and customer requirements
  • Managing procurement of direct and indirect materials within an automotive Tier 1 environment
  • Sourcing, negotiating and managing suppliers across cost, quality, delivery and service
  • Driving supplier cost reduction, value engineering and continuous improvement
  • Managing supplier performance, audits and development
  • Working closely with Planning to ensure material availability and production continuity
  • Supporting NPI and new programme launches through effective supplier management
  • Owning KPIs covering cost, quality, inventory and supplier performance
  • Supporting inventory optimisation and working capital improvements
  • Ensuring purchasing activity meets customer requirements and industry standards, including IATF 16949
  • Reporting on purchasing performance, supplier metrics and cost saving initiatives
